Nairn to Birmingham

Updated: 28 May 2026

The journey from Nairn to Birmingham covers approximately 650 kilometers. You will travel south via the A9, passing through Perth and Glasgow, before joining the M6 towards Birmingham. Birmingham is a major city in the West Midlands of England. By train, the journey involves a change at Inverness and Glasgow, taking around 9 to 10 hours. Driving is the most efficient method, taking approximately 8 hours.

Total Distance: 650 km driving distance; 550 km straight-line air distance.
